We had a nice trip for the Memorial Day weekend...it started with only Marcia and I, along with Danny the Wicked Spaniel...but both girls (Linda (22) and Alice (20)) were able to come along!!!! Four adults, two dogs, a tear and a canoe in a Honda Element!!! Here were are boarding the ferry in Juneau...kinda looks like Ma and Pa Kettle heading out with crap lashed to the roof rack in dry bags...I can trully say I understand the phenomina of people walking up to check out the Tear while waiting at the ferry terminal line...

Image

We got to Haines, and the Chilkoot Campground was closed...so off we went through Mud Bay. This area has some really nice hanging glaciers and wide open spaces for the dogs to run. There were a lot of boaters out on the ocean after King Salmon...

Image

Image

Here's is Linda at the camp a Chilkat Campground. We set up a big tent for the girls along with the Tear for us..

Image

And off for canoeing back on Lutak Road...Hit a bit of mud...

Image

This stream has four big salmon runs over the course of the summer and fall...we were about a month early for the first run (and accompanying bears). It was really nice though. The river is an outfall for a lake about a mile or two further up the road....

Image

And Danny the Wicked Spaniel had a ball. Let it be said that he was able to find all sorts of unmentionables to roll in!!!!

Image

And finally...here is the Haines terminal for the way back!!!
